Gutters can be a great addition to many homes. They help maintain the quality of your roof by deterring water and directing runoff to help protect and maintain your roof. Often times, your gutters may need maintenance, some of the most common causes of gutter problems are:
· Debris build up – over time debris from trees begins to collect on the siding and downspouts, causing a clogged gutter system. Not properly maintaining the gutters can lead to costly repairs. It is important to keep your gutters clear of all debris, particularly if you have a number of trees surrounding your home area.
· Improper alignment (pitch) – if not aligned properly, this can cause a buildup of water on certain places in the gutter system. During heavy rains, the gathering of all that water can put pressure on the gutters, causing it them to sag and slip from its joints.
· Leakage from cracked joints – joints on the gutters (especially in corners where two gutters meet) can start to slip, causing water to fall through these problem spots. It is important to repair the joints so that you get the correct flow, and prevent the water from draining into unwanted sections of your home. The heavy downpour from these cracks can often times ruin landscape around your home.
